Thanks to the magic of time-lapse videography, we see how the Dallas Cowboys Stadium in Arlington, Texas magically transforms into a basketball court for the 2010 NBA All-Star Game.

Man, a basketball court’s size really pales in comparison to a football stadium. Even the giant monitor hanging from the rafters dwarfs the court!

The 2010 NBA All-Star Game set the record for the largest crowd ever to attend a basketball game with 108,713 people and it really helped that it was  held in a football stadium. Dwyane Wade was named MVP.
